FRONT DISC BRAKE : Brake Burnishing
INFOID:0000000009756209
CAUTION:
• Burnish contact surfaces between brake pads and disc rotor according to the following procedure
after refinishing the disc rotor, replacing brake pads or if a soft pedal occurs at very low mileage.
• Be careful of vehicle speed. Brakes do not operate firmly/securely until pads and disc rotor are
securely seated.
• Only perform this procedure under safe road and traffic conditions. Use extreme caution.
1. Drive the vehicle on straight, flat road.
2. Depress the brake pedal until the vehicle stops.
3. Release the brake pedal for a few minutes to allow the brake components to cool.
4. Repeat steps 1 to 3 until pad and disc rotor are securely seated.

REAR DRUM BRAKE : Brake Burnishing
INFOID:0000000009756212
CAUTION:
• Burnish contact surfaces between brake drum and brake lining according to the following procedure
after refinishing or replacing brake drum, or if a soft pedal occurs at very low mileage.
• Be careful of vehicle speed because the brake does not operate firmly/securely until brake drum and
brake lining are securely fitted.
• Only perform this procedure under safe road and traffic conditions. Use extreme caution.
1. Drive the vehicle on straight, flat road.
2. Depress the brake pedal until the vehicle stops.
3. Release the brake pedal for a few minutes to allow the brake components to cool.
4. Repeat steps 1 to 3 until pad and disc rotor are securely seated.

2. Secure the disc rotor to the wheel hub and bearing assembly
with wheel nuts at two wheel nut locations.
3. Inspect the runout with a dial gauge, measured at 10 mm (0.39
in) inside the disc edge.
4. Find the installation position with a minimum runout by shifting
the disc rotor-to-wheel hub and bearing assembly installation
position by one hole at a time if the runout exceeds the limit
value.
5. Refinish the disc rotor if the runout is outside the limit even after performing the above operation. When
refinishing, use Tool.
Thickness
Check the thickness of the disc rotor using a micrometer. Replace
the disc rotor if the thickness is below the minimum thickness.

- Hook a spring balance to the ball stud and inner socket measuring
point (*) and pull the spring balance. Make sure that the spring bal-
ance reads the specified value when ball stud and inner socket
start to move. Replace outer socket and inner socket if they are
outside the specification.
• Ball joint rotating torque
- Make sure that the reading is within the following specified range
using Tool (A). Replace outer socket if the reading is outside the
specification.
• Ball joint axial end play
- Apply an axial load of 490 N (50 kg, 111 lb.) to ball stud. Measuring
the amount of stud movement using a dial gauge, make sure that
the value is within specification. Replace outer socket (A) and
inner socket (B) if the measured value is outside specification.
